ogoffart commented 6 months ago

Thanks for reporting the problem

We have two problem:

  1. the lsp is panicking because we unwrap the error from slint::run_event_loop instead of properly reporting it as an error and maybe use a fallback. This is tracked in https://github.com/slint-ui/slint/issues/204

  2. You have a problem that you can't connect to the display. This error comes from the linuxkms backend. The linuxkms is used because the winit backend failled to initialize, probably because the X11 DISPLAY or equivalent wayland env variable were not properly set. And you probably don't want anyway that linuxkms backend takes your whole screen

Since the LSP Preview bug is already tracked by #204, the actual problem seems to be a configuration problem.

I'm just going to keep this bug open because I think the linuxkms error is less than ideal.
